EXCEEDS logo
Exceeds
Jianguo-Genius

PROFILE

Jianguo-genius

Herman Song Yang contributed to the metersphere/metersphere repository by building and refining automated test management features that streamline API scenario imports, test plan configuration, and coverage analytics. He enhanced import workflows to ensure data integrity and correct project linkage, reworked JMX and HAR file parsing for accurate scenario translation, and implemented batch scheduling and status-based filtering for test plans. Using Java, Spring Boot, and Vue.js, Herman optimized backend data handling and frontend usability, addressing both feature delivery and reliability fixes. His work improved traceability, reduced manual corrections, and enabled more granular organization of test resources, demonstrating depth in backend and integration engineering.

Overall Statistics

Feature vs Bugs

56%Features

Repository Contributions

55Total
Bugs
14
Commits
55
Features
18
Lines of code
7,968
Activity Months3

Work History

December 2024

18 Commits • 6 Features

Dec 1, 2024

December 2024 monthly summary for metersphere/metersphere. Delivered a set of features and reliability fixes that improve test planning efficiency, API coverage accuracy, and data quality. Key features delivered include Test Plan Status Filtering and Archiving, API Test Coverage Accuracy, API Definition Coverage Filtering, Test Plan Dropdown Endpoint, and Test Plan Resource Association Filter. Major bugs fixed include JMeter Header Import bug fix and Project/Module Tree improvements, along with Test Plan Data Model and Parsing cleanup to standardize naming and parsing logic. These changes reduce time-to-configure test runs, improve traceability of test coverage, and strengthen hierarchical data retrieval across the workspace.

November 2024

30 Commits • 10 Features

Nov 1, 2024

2024-11 月度工作摘要:在 metersphere/metersphere 项目中实现多项核心特性交付、统计能力提升与关键稳定性修复,显著提升测试自动化覆盖、场景与测试计划管理效率,以及对接 Har/Swagger 生态的能力,支撑更高的上线质量与运营数据洞察。

October 2024

7 Commits • 2 Features

Oct 1, 2024

October 2024: Delivered enhancements to API and JMX import workflows for metersphere/metersphere, focusing on data integrity, correct project linkage, and maintainability. Key outcomes include: API Scenario Import Improvements delivering better support for related resources, improved matching/association logic, and ensuring unique configuration identifiers; JMX Import Improvements delivering more accurate conversion of JMeter controllers to metersphere components, refined script language handling, and improved extractor defaults. Major fixes addressed API Scenario Import Data Integrity and Project Linkage, correcting target project references, ensuring imported steps reference the target project's test cases, and preventing duplicate API creation during import. Impact: increased end-to-end reliability of test scenario imports, reduced post-import corrections, and smoother onboarding of test scenarios. Technologies/skills demonstrated: import tooling, JMX parsing and translation, data integrity and project linkage, refactoring and maintainability.

Activity

Loading activity data...

Quality Metrics

Correctness83.8%
Maintainability83.2%
Architecture78.4%
Performance74.8%
AI Usage22.2%

Skills & Technologies

Programming Languages

JavaJavaScriptSQLTypeScriptVueXML

Technical Skills

API DevelopmentAPI RefactoringAPI TestingAlgorithm OptimizationBackend DevelopmentBatch OperationsCode RefactoringData HandlingData ImportData Import/ExportData ParsingData StructuresDatabase InteractionDatabase QueryingError Handling

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

metersphere/metersphere

Oct 2024 Dec 2024
3 Months active

Languages Used

JavaJavaScriptTypeScriptVueXMLSQL

Technical Skills

API TestingBackend DevelopmentCode RefactoringData ImportData Import/ExportJMeter

Generated by Exceeds AIThis report is designed for sharing and indexing